TWI: Software Reset
TWI: Disabling Does not Operate Correctly
TWI: NACK Status Bit Lost
TWI: Possible Receive Holding Register Corruption
USART: CTS in Hardware Handshaking
USART: Hardware Handshaking – Two Characters Sent
None.
When a software reset is performed during a frame and when TWCK is low, it is impossible to
initiate a new transfer in READ or WRITE mode.
None.
Any transfer in progress is immediately frozen if the Control Register (TWI_CR) is written with
the bit MSDIS at 1. Furthermore, the status bits TXCOMP and TXRDY in the Status Register
(TWI_SR) are not reset.
The user must wait for the end of transfer before disabling the TWI. In addition, the interrupts
must be disabled before disabling the TWI.
During a master frame, if TWI_SR is read between the Non Acknowledge condition detection
and the TXCOMP bit rising in the TWI_SR, the NACK bit is not set.
The user must wait for the TXCOMP status bit by interrupt and must not read the TWI_SR as
long as transmission is not completed.
TXCOMP and NACK fields are set simultaneously and the NACK field is reset after the read of
the TWI_SR.
When loading the TWI_RHR, the transfer direction is ignored. The last data byte received in the
TWI_RHR is corrupted at the end of the first subsequent transmit data byte. Neither RXRDY nor
OVERRUN status bits are set if this occurs.
The user must be sure that received data is read before transmitting any new data.
When Hardware Handshaking is used and if CTS goes low near the end of the starting bit, a
character can be lost.
CTS must not go low during a time slot occurring between 2 Master Clock periods before the
starting bit and 16 Master Clock periods after the rising edge of the starting bit.
If CTS switches from 0 to 1 during the TX of a character and if the holding register (US_THR) is
not empty, the content of US_THR will also be transmitted.
